Club Notes Week Ending 6th Oct. 2019

County Intermediate & Juv. UnEven Ages XC


The second Cross Country Championship took place in Lissivigeen, Killarney on Sunday 6th October. Conditions were ideal for the County Intermediate & Juvenile UnEven ages with clear skies and a wonderful backdrop of the Killarney mountain range. 
The first race of the morning was the ladies Intermediate & U19's 4000m. Well done to Siobhan Riordan & Catherine Riordan who represented our club and did very well. An Riocht AC made it a hat trick taking all three Intermediate positions. 
We had three athletes competing in the Intermediate Men's 7000m race. All three ran well over the seven lap course with George McCarthy running a solid race to finish in second place behind the overall winner, Donal Leahy of Listowel AC. Dermot Dineen pulled away from a small group to finish strong taking the third place podium and Brendan Lynch finished in fifth place. The team of three were also winners of the team event.
In the juveniles, Nathan Herlihy had a great run to come fourth in the U9 750m. 
Leah McCarthy, running out of age, in the U11 1500m did very well to finish in 8th place. 
In the U11 boys race we had eight competitors. Our individual medal winners were brothers Isaac & Ryan Vickers who finished in 2nd & 6th place respectively. With Kevin O'Shea 13th & Jack Doolan 18th they were second team winners. The other team members who won bronze team were Tomas Lynch 19th, Peter Herlihy 21st, Evan Spillane 22nd & Jack Teahan 23rd. 
In the U13 Girls 2500m, Rhian McCarthy ran a great race to finish third overall, just behind was Mairead Walsh 5th and Laura Bradley was 18th. Unfortunately they were short one more for team prize. Tiarnan Lynch, out of age, won individual in the U13's where he finished in 5th place. Also out of age in the U15 girls 3500m was Eabha McCarthy who had a great last lap passing more than three runners to finish in 4th place. Sadhbh Teahan did very well also in what is a long distance for young athletes to finish in 10th place. 
The final race of the afternoon was the U17 Boys & Girls. Cian Spillane had a great solid run over the four laps to finish in second place. Shauna McCarthy had a very comfortable win in the girls race. Shauna has won both age categories at county level for the past five years. A great achievement.
